But there are also contraindications. Changing the shower in the bathroom, especially in the winter months, can play a trick on our hearts. So much so that the risk of cardiac arrest is multiplied by ten when we immerse ourselves in hot water during the cold season, the sudden change in body temperature - especially if there are few degrees - causes a sudden drop in blood pressure.
There are other undesirable consequences of soaking. When the circulatory system has to manage such high temperatures, the blood vessels dilate, the resistance they offer to the blood drops and the tension falls on the floor. This can cause dizziness and even fainting, as well as a feeling of fatigue or intense headaches.
